Got another arcade cabinet: Golden Tee 2004!

Friend of mine called today and asked if I wanted some parts from a game he was parting out. I went over and he was taking the coin door and bill acceptor off a complete Golden Tee Golf game that he was no longer in need of! I asked him what else he was taking and he said he was done. He had the trak-ball removed, buttons and all that was still in the cabinet was the monitor. I asked if I could just have the whole thing, he agreed and help me take it to my back yard. Got everything, minus coin & bill unit. He said it worked but had a "boot-up" problem.

 

Thinking about putting MAME into it and got wondering if its possible to use the board and hard drive?

 

I believe it might have a security chip on the motherboard that will only boot the game and nothing else right? If removed, could it work like a regular computer board?
